Repairing HP mini data cassette
Dear all,

I am trying to revitalise my HP collection. I have a 82161A digital data cassette drive with only 1 working data cassette, 1 badly repaired non functioning data cassette and 2 new unpacked data cassettes. The tape connections in the new data cassettes are also broken (I assume the adhesive tape is released) and I will try to repair those. I looked at a Youtube repairing video where one opened an audio cassette case with a sharp Stanley knive.
Does one of you have some experience with opening these small cassettes without breaking them?
I have some experience with splicing audio tapes, so I think I might be able to repair it with a 1/8 inch splicing block and subsequent adhesive tape.
Thanks on forehand for your advice.
